  • When someone drunks alcohol, it goes into their bloodstream where it affects the central nervous system (the brain and spinal cord), which controls virtually all body functions.
  • The human body can only metabolize a certain amount of alcohol every hour, no matter how much alcohol is consumed at any given time, a process which can vary depending on a range of factors, including liver size and body mass.
  • Opiate dependence even after short term use is can develop especially if a person uses a lot of opiates or even uses opiates occasionally over a long period of time.
  • When someone stops taking crystal meth they often experience long periods of sleep and increased appetite because most users go on a "run", taking drugs for one or more days in a row and don't sleep or eat.

Once a person comes to terms with the reality that they need help to resolve drug addiction, the next move is picking the appropriate drug rehab for them. Some drug treatment programs don't call for any form of inpatient stay and offer services on an outpatient basis for instance. At this form of drug rehab the particular person gets treatment through the day and returns home in the evening. While this form of drug rehab may appear practical, it will not provide the ideal treatment environment for someone who desires to step away from drug influences and other circumstances which could compromise one's sobriety. The most established and successful treatment settings are those which call for an inpatient or residential stay, so that the person can concentrate entirely on bettering themselves and healing from addiction, not on every day interruptions and drug addiction triggers.

For instance, someone or some circumstance in one's environment could be the actual cause of one's drug use. If the particular person returns to this every day while in drug rehab, all gains will be lost and most will usually relapse. There are also varying lengths of stay even in inpatient and residential drug rehab programs, with treatment curriculums which range from 30 days to up to a year for some. As a rule of thumb, an individual who is set on resolving addiction problems once and for all should remain in drug rehab as long as it takes. A month in treatment is barely enough time to even recuperate physically from continual substance abuse. A significant amount of time is essential, even months in some instances, to benefit from intensive therapy and other treatment tools to heal mentally and emotionally so that one can genuinely make a clean start once treatment is finished.
